VESTAMID® eCO LX9012 T8 B80

Generic Family: Polyamide 12Supplied by: Evonik Industries AG
Heat stabilized and light resistant polyamide 12 compound

VESTAMID® eCO LX9012 T8 B80 has been especially developed for the extrusion and co-extrusion of ski upper and decorative films. Decoration on the bottom side of injection molded sports shoe soles is a further application field.

Films made of VESTAMID® eCO LX9012 T8 B80 feature high transparency, good screen and sublimation printing, outstanding scratch resistance, and excellent impact strength at low temperatures. The semi-crystalline compounds based on PA 12 absorb only low quantities of water. Therefore, molded parts show excellent dimensional stability, constantly high impact strength, low coefficient of friction and good chemical resistance at changing ambient humidity.

eCO stands for Evoniks aim to reduce CO2 trough use of renewable or circular feedstocks via mass-balance approach.

VESTAMID® eCO LX9012 T8 B80 is supplied as cylindrical granules, ready for processing in moisture-proof packaging.
